Michael Otto


Michael Otto: Investor in Germany, Europe

Michael Otto is a Investor located in Germany, Europe.

SWFI Event

Michael Otto Details

Name:Michael Otto
Legal Name:Michael Otto
Region:Europe
Country:Germany
Type:Investor

Michael Otto Contact Information

Address:Hamburg Germany
Region:Europe
Country:Germany

Get News Stories Delivered to Your Inbox